Alibek Omarov
fa03ed3bce
wscript: fix mod_options.txt parsing under Python2
1 year ago
Alibek Omarov
7d65d9f3bd
wscript: set default prefix, do not install without destdir as we don't follow typical unix filesystem hierarchy
2 years ago
Alibek Omarov
036db21bc1
wscript: fix MSVC_TARGETS defined after XP compatibility check was made (thus fixing IndexOutOfRange error)
2 years ago
Alibek Omarov
b9ce326714
wscript: rework waf script, add mod_options.txt support, synchronize with engine as much as possible
2 years ago
fgsfds
fa29254828
psvita support
2 years ago
fgsfds
d32df80822
nswitch support
2 years ago
Alibek Omarov
4ba4f5a9bc
wscript: keep lib prefix only on selected platforms, e.g. Android
2 years ago
Alibek Omarov
468780d997
wscript: sync with cmake, enable goldsrc support by default
2 years ago
Alibek Omarov
8a43dfbaab
waifulib: migrate to compiler_optimizations waf tool
3 years ago
Alibek Omarov
cc4aebd61a
wscript: remove dead option
3 years ago
Alibek Omarov
dd470d6700
waifulib: xcompile: upgrade tool
3 years ago
Andrey Akhmichin
0fab78ad24
wscript: update.
4 years ago
Andrey Akhmichin
f0b649f507
wscript: update.
4 years ago
Alibek Omarov
a7103c1c14
waf: upgrade to waifu 1.1.0
4 years ago
Alibek Omarov
dc774318b2
wscript: add DEST_CPU msvc hack to HLSDK too, reorganize loading tools
4 years ago
Alibek Omarov
0c6d6b83f5
Fix DLLs installation for bshift
4 years ago
Ivan 'provod' Avdeev
715620135a
Make it possible to complie 64-bit binary on windows
...
The change is to supply `x64` to MSVC_TARGETS if `-8` is specified.
Note that it will set DEST_CPU to `amd64` instead of expected `x86_64`
on Windows. This is known to break things for xash3d-fwgs repo. But for
this one it seems just fine? I haven't investigated it further.
4 years ago
Andrey Akhmichin
47c13ef873
server: Use separate cvar instead of macro for monster yaw speed fix.
4 years ago
Logan
4be53d8527
server: fix monster yaw speed ( #137 )
...
This makes the yaw speed for all monsters (scientists, headcrabs, etc.) framerate independent.
Fix by Solokiller with mikela-valve's adjustments:
https://github.com/ValveSoftware/halflife/issues/2458
4 years ago
Andrey Akhmichin
d7509365f0
wscript: Fix compilation.
4 years ago
Andrey Akhmichin
8e4ded4017
wscript: update yet again.
4 years ago
mittorn
2ba9071798
check if cmath useful, remove posix defines when using owcc
5 years ago
Aimless-Wanderer
701d78dcec
wscript: fix join method usage
5 years ago
Alibek Omarov
e53f15cabf
wscript: add option to turn on simple mod hacks
5 years ago
Alibek Omarov
b4d3b5d8be
wscript: enable library naming
5 years ago
Alibek Omarov
94d4c6a0e3
wscript: enable library naming for Waf
5 years ago
Alibek Omarov
e068ebf610
wscript: fix typo
5 years ago
Alibek Omarov
76c2f90249
wscript: workaround bug when CC_VERSION is not set for msvc
5 years ago
Alibek Omarov
d3ad80a14c
wscript: motomagx changes
5 years ago
Andrey Akhmichin
e976cf2de4
wscript: Use better check for tgmath.h.
5 years ago
Jonathan Poncelet
1bc65c15f5
Build: Fixed GiveFnptrsToDll not being found on Windows
...
Also fixed server DLL being named server.dll instead of hl.dll.
5 years ago
Alibek Omarov
ae6299f636
wscript: use taskgen counter to solve problem with compiling shared code instead of hardcoding indexes
5 years ago
Andrey Akhmichin
23a9ab7b4b
wscript: add check for tgmath.h header.
5 years ago
Alibek Omarov
fea49e2187
waf: upgrade to latest waifu revision
5 years ago
Alibek Omarov
b141cac977
wscript: remove DEST_OS2
5 years ago
Alibek Omarov
17e1af726d
wscript: remove DEST_OS2
5 years ago
Alibek Omarov
d9c5b04c54
waf: add strip_on_install plugin from engine repository
5 years ago
Alibek Omarov
a9d9f475b0
wscript: enable clang_compilation_database in options
5 years ago
Aydar Zarifullin
c2e3b70b37
hlsdk wscript fix ( #82 )
...
* hlsdk wscript fix
* indentation fix
6 years ago
Alibek Omarov
ef9129b89e
waflib: xcompile: update to latest version from Xash3D FWGS repository
6 years ago
Alibek Omarov
a699702c00
wscript: strip lib prefix for HLSDK
6 years ago
Alibek Omarov
470a71540b
waf: initial deploy
6 years ago